Bengaluru to get ₹1.04 lakh crore development boost: Deputy CM D.K. Shivakumar

Deputy Chief Minister D.K. Shivakumar announced that the Karnataka government has prepared a comprehensive ₹1.04 lakh crore development plan for Bengaluru, which will be implemented over the next four to five years. The initiative includes tunnel roads, elevated corridors, double-decker flyovers, buffer roads, LED streetlight installations, and city beautification projects such as decorative lighting.
